Oklahoma football: 5 things to watch in 2016

The Oklahoma Sooners are looking to get back to the top of the mountain in college football and they have a pretty great chance to do so this year. They won the Big 12 championship and made the College Football Playoff and they return a lot of players who should help them do much of the same this year.

The Sooners are one of the best teams in the country and have an offensive unit that could absolutely run over any defense they match up with this year.

On the other side of the coin, they are in dire straits and will need some big contributions from their younger players going into the season.

Let’s take a look at five things to watch for the Oklahoma Sooners in the 2016 college football season.
